Windows Server 2012 Beta with SMB 3.0 – Demo at Interop shows SMB Direct at 5.8 Gbytes/sec over Mellanox ConnectX-3 network adapters

The Interop conference happened this week in Las Vegas (see http://www.interop.com/lasvegas) and Mellanox showcased their high-speed ConnectX-3 network adapters during the event. They showed an interesting setup with Windows Server 2012 Beta and SMB 3.0 that showed amazing remote file performance using SMB Direct (SMB over RDMA).
